Steps to become a physical therapist in Berrien Springs MI

1. Learn about The Position

The basic duty of a physical therapist is to aid clients who have suffered accidents or have disabilities to reclaim use of their bodies; on the other hand, this is merely the common function. Difficulties are common in this industry due to the sensitive nature of the job. Make sure you take this into consideration.

Parkinson’s Disease, brain and spinal chord injuries, these are just a few of the severe medical conditions you could face as a physical therapist. Afflictions such as this are very tricky and call for customized therapy strategies. The techniques you will need to care for these patients long-term will be acquired in an academy setting and on the job.

3. Obtain Related Experience

One of the most essential steps to become a physical therapist is to build up experience in the field. It is vital to carry out a postgraduate residency after graduating; however, it is recommended that people seek volunteer work in recovery centers during the course of undergraduate study. This may help in achieving expertise in physical therapy, particularly when finding clinics emphasizing neurological rehabilitation. Hours acquired through this kind of volunteer work will be attributed to your post graduate residency.
